Munich. An accident occurred at Ludwigsbrücke: a pensioner (73) has been run over by a car at the tram stop, reports TZ.
On Thursday morning the elderly man was about to cross the road to the Ludwigsbrücke tram stop. He overlooked an approaching Mercedes. The 73 years old was hit by the car and thrown onto the road behind the Mercedes. He suffered multiple fractures and severe injuries to the head.
The emergency medical team and paramedics of the Fire Service initiated necessary resuscitation measures. An ambulance took the man to the emergency room of a Munich clinic. There, the man later died of his injuries.
